Output 21eb90be81ef82144a98726805dd003594f5d4cbb27f2df268fc1832d051e630:0
- value
- 1043096
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e9784508f9383869a349b1ac138609a5b4daf40 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5kqgGEKCpsTey8YzGGkw8zyDVREExxwN
- transaction
- 21eb90be81ef82144a98726805dd003594f5d4cbb27f2df268fc1832d051e630